> From: Michael Heerdegen <michael_heerdegen <at> web.de>
> Date: Sat, 22 Apr 2017 05:41:22 +0200
> 
> ps-print.el has become non-functional for me in compiled form since some
> time (days?  weeks? ... not much longer).  It produces only empty .ps
> documents.
> 
> Here is a very simple recipe for emacs -Q (from *scratch*):
> 
> M-: (require 'ps-print) RET
> 
> M-: (ps-spool-buffer-with-faces) RET
> 
> Switch to the buffer *Post Script*.  The created document ends with
> 
> 
> | BeginDoc
> | %%EndSetup
> | 
> | %%Trailer
> | %%Pages: 0
> | 
> | EndDoc
> | 
> | %%EOF
> 
> If I save the buffer to a .ps file and open it with a viewer, I get a
> blank page.
> 
> Now I repeat the recipe with the source file ps-print.el loaded.  I get
> the expected result this time.  Hmm.

Does the problem go away if you byte-compile ps-print.el with Emacs
25?
